Young Carers Service Criteria

To be eligible for referral to Stirling Carers Centre, a young person must:

  • Be located within the Stirling Council area

  • Be aged between 7 and 17

  • Agree to be involved with the service

  • Be impacted physically, emotionally and/or academically by their caring role

  • Have a significant role in looking after someone else who is experiencing an illness or disability

They must also have a high level of responsibility for and be performing a wide range of caring duties, which could include:

  • Daily household management
    including laundry, cleaning, cooking, taking responsibility for food shopping etc.

  • Financial and practical management
    such as helping with financial matters, paying bills and using other methods of communication e.g. Makaton

  • On-going personal care for the person they care for
    including helping someone get washed and dressed, collecting and giving medication to the cared for and taking care of the cared for during the night.

  • Providing regular emotional support
    including supporting the person they care for when they are upset and/or worried, keeping the person they care for company on an on-going basis and accompanying the person when they have to go out.

The support offered by Stirling Young Carers is a time limited service. An approximate timescale will be identified with each individual Young Carer at the beginning of their journey of support.

If it becomes apparent that there are issues out with their caring role that require additional support, a referral to another agency may be more appropriate.
